The Use Case and Smart Grid Architecture Model Approach The IEC 62559-2 Use Case Template and the SGAM applied in various domains /
This book introduces readers to the fundamentals of the IEC 62559 Use Case Methodology, explains how it is related to the Smart Grid Architecture Model (SGAM), and details how a holistic view for both architecture and requirements engineering can be achieved.
